Output 66d0368aaa66546329545cb7f08fbdf83974d34ed6fd64c64fa604b5cdbc1489:4

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f57b8051ee9603d0fb52a25cabe4f05285bd3c OP_EQUAL
address
32bg5gsZ2Sp9D6XAZ25HD8CSqWYRyJagkF
transaction
66d0368aaa66546329545cb7f08fbdf83974d34ed6fd64c64fa604b5cdbc1489
confirmations
426978
spent
true